Though the raid netted very little in the way of actual drugs, what it did net was a.. more The Globe Theatre, where most of Shakespeare's plays debuted, burned down on June 29, 1613. The Globe was built by Shakespeare's acting company, the Lord Chamberlain's Men, in 1599 from the timbers of London's very first permanent theater, Burbage's Theater, built in 1576. IBM's Transition to Teaching program reimburses $15, 000 of expenses to become certified as a teacher — an undertaking that Keith Gordon, 64, an IT software specialist, accomplished four years ago while working at IBM. To qualify, applicants must have been employed at IBM for at least a decade. "I was able to take a personal leave for three and a half months to student teach, " Mr. Gordon said. "I also had security in knowing if it didn't turn out to be what I thought it was going to be, I had a job to come back to. " Since 2014, Mr. Gordon, of Darnestown, Md., has worked as a math, computer science and engineering teacher at Poolesville High School in Poolesville, Md. Like Ms. O'Bryant, Mr. Gordon made his career transition gradually. To earn a master's degree in teaching, he enrolled in one night class each semester for three years and took summer classes.

Serving Suggestions Use As A Spread You can use this flavorful mixture as a spread on sandwiches, burgers or even hotdogs. Try It As A Dip As a dip it is particularly wonderful with vegetables, especially carrots, celery, cucumber (preferably seedless) or even fruits like apples. Baked tofu sticks are also great to enjoy with this dip as are crackers, Pringles, potato chips or corn chips. It is also surprisingly good on cocktail franks or meatballs. Use It As A Sauce Tonight we tried this red pepper dip heated and used as a sauce on oven roasted cauliflower, bell peppers, sauteed mushrooms and onions and pierogies. It was fantastic, highly recommend trying it. Dust the pierogies with a little paprika and dress the vegetables with a small amount of lemon or lime juice.

Even repeated usage of this substance does not pose any health threat. Availability You can buy Borax in almost any hardware store, supermarket, or pharmacy. This is easily accessible whenever you see the threat of termites or a recurrence of infestation. Affordable Borax is perhaps the most affordable termite treatment available anywhere. Some professional treatments can go from a few hundred to a couple of thousand dollars, depending on the severity of the infestation. Limitations Efficacy Borax in powder and/or liquid form can only penetrate wood to a certain extent. This means the innermost part of the wood may not be protected and remains vulnerable to termites. Another factor that affects efficacy is repeated exposure to soaking rains. It also does not work too well on soil treatments. Potential for Recurrence Since Borax does not seep into wood too well, there is a very good chance of the problem recurring at some point. It can provide, at best, a temporary solution to a serious problem.

For example, Japanese Americans suffered under the Alien Land Law of 1913 and other racist exclusionary laws legally preventing them from owning land and property in more than a dozen American states until the Immigration and Nationality Act of 1952. During World War II, more than 120, 000 Japanese Americans were interned. However, by 1959, the income disparity between Japanese Americans and white Americans had almost disappeared. Today, Japanese Americans outperform white Americans by large margins in income statistics, education outcomes, and test scores, and have much lower incarceration rates. Countries with the lowest tuition fees for Bachelors in Design Generally speaking, Design deals with learning how to execute any type of item that future customers will find very useful, easy to use with aesthetic features, as well. Bachelor's degrees in Design are very sought these days, as elements of design are the first step before creating any type of product. If that sounds amazing, you should know that the average tuition fees for Design Bachelor's degrees are: Netherlands: 5, 500 EUR/year Hungary: 3, 000 EUR/year Switzerland: 2, 000 EUR/year Italy: 1, 300 EUR/year The wide field of Design includes sub-specialisations, such as graphic design, which implies more elements related to visual communication, or interior design, that integrates knowledge of ergonomics, architectural planning, and technical graphics. Design graduates can find jobs like industrial designer, graphic designer, web designer, interior designer, and even more 'designer's.
